#fb1fc5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b1fc5 is composed of 98.4% red, 12.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 21.5%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 314.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 55.3%. #fb1fc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3eff with #f7008b.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#fb1fc5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fb1fc5 has RGB values of R:251, G:31,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.22,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16457669.

Hex triplet fb1fc5 #fb1fc5
RGB Decimal 251, 31, 197 rgb(251,31,197)
RGB Percent 98.4, 12.2, 77.3 rgb(98.4%,12.2%,77.3%)
CMYK 0, 88, 22, 2
HSL 314.7°, 96.5, 55.3 hsl(314.7,96.5%,55.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 314.7°, 87.6, 98.4
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 57.583, 87.402, -32.505
XYZ 50.352, 25.525, 55.095
xyY 0.384, 0.195, 25.525
CIE-LCH 57.583, 93.251, 339.6
CIE-LUV 57.583, 103.809, -63.263
Hunter-Lab 50.522, 89.485, -29.291
Binary 11111011, 00011111, 11000101

Shades and Tints of #fb1fc5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070006 is the darkest color, while #fff3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b1fc5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92888f is the less saturated color, while #fb1fc5 is the most saturated one.
